1. Blockonomics

Blockonomics offers a WHMCS plugin that allows users to accept Bitcoin, Bitcoin Cash, and USDT. It is one of the most popular plugins, and is extremely easy to use. It has a wide variety of guides in multiple formats, including a strong help site and an active YouTube channel.

Additionally, its plugin integrates easily with WHMCS, and offers a wide range of customizations depending on what you need from the plugin. It integrates seamlessly with the checkout page.

Setting it up is simple:
- Download the plugin
- Upload the plugin to your WHMCS store and activate it
- Enter in your wallet Xpub on the Blockonomics website

Finally, it has one of the strongest support teams in the business, with developers running the tech support desks. If there is a problem for some reason, tech support is on it quickly.

2.SpectroCoin

SpectroCoin allows business owners to accept crypto payments through their WHMCS plugin as well, and it is easy to set up, even if it’s slightly more involved than Blockonomics. Because SpectroCoin is custodial, meaning they hold your bitcoin rather than sending directly to your wallet like Blockonomics, it takes more time to set up an account.

Here’s what setup looks like:
- Follow the 6 steps to set up a merchant account
- Download the plugin
- Upload the plugin to WHMCS
- Set up merchant keys in the plugin
- Activate the plugin
- Enter in the Merchant and Project ID into the plugin

However, once those steps are finished, one has a functioning crypto payment option.

3.Plisio

Plisio is another custodial payment system, and so it requires more setup, but is still user friendly.

Setup involves:
- Generate an API key in your account
- Download the plugin
- Upload the plugin to WHMCS
- Activate the plugin
- Enter in the secret phrase

Once that is done, it allows you to start accepting crypto payments to WHMCS.
